Qt 开发环境搭建完整文档

张开发
2026/4/14 3:27:08 15 分钟阅读

分享文章

Qt 开发环境搭建完整文档
一、文档说明本文档详细介绍Windows 系统下 Qt 开发环境的完整搭建流程包含 Qt 下载、安装、环境配置、项目测试适用于 Qt 5.x/ Qt 6.x 版本零基础也可直接跟着操作。二、环境准备1. 系统要求Windows 10 / Windows 1164 位内存 ≥ 4GB硬盘剩余空间 ≥ 20GB网络通畅用于下载安装包和组件2. 版本选择新手推荐Qt 5.15.2稳定、兼容性强、教程最多进阶推荐Qt 6.5新版本功能更全部分旧库不兼容本文以Qt 5.15.2为例演示。三、Qt 下载1. 官方下载地址Qt 官方离线安装包推荐无需联网反复下载https://download.qt.io/archive/qt/2. 下载步骤打开链接 → 找到5.15→ 点击5.15.2选择 Windows 版本安装包qt-opensource-windows-x86-5.15.2.exe等待下载完成安装包大小约 3.5GB注意无需注册 Qt 账号安装时可跳过登录。四、Qt 安装步骤1. 启动安装程序双击下载好的.exe安装包弹出登录界面 → 点击Skip跳过登录2. 选择安装路径重要安装路径不能有中文、空格、特殊字符推荐路径D:\Qt\Qt5.15.23. 选择安装组件核心步骤勾选以下必选组件其他默认不选Qt 5.15.2✅MinGW 7.3.0 64-bit编译器必选✅Qt Creator 4.13.1IDE 开发工具必选✅Sources源码可选建议勾选✅Qt WebEngine网页组件常用Tools✅MinGW 7.3.0 64-bit✅Qt Creator总结只需要勾选MinGW 编译器 Qt Creator 对应版本库即可。4. 同意协议勾选I have read and agree...→ 点击Next开始安装。安装时间约 10~20 分钟取决于电脑性能。五、环境变量配置可选推荐配置配置后可在命令行使用 qmake、编译器等工具右键此电脑→ 属性 → 高级系统设置 → 环境变量在系统变量中找到Path→ 编辑添加以下 2 条路径根据自己安装路径修改plaintextD:\Qt\Qt5.15.2\5.15.2\mingw73_64\bin D:\Qt\Qt5.15.2\Tools\mingw730_64\bin点击确定保存配置。验证环境是否配置成功按下Win R→ 输入cmd打开命令行输入命令bash运行qmake -v g -v出现版本信息说明配置成功。六、启动 Qt Creator 并创建第一个项目1. 启动 IDE安装完成后桌面会生成Qt Creator快捷方式双击打开。2. 创建新项目点击Create Project选择Application → Qt Widgets Application→ Choose设置项目名称和路径无中文、无空格类名默认MainWindow即可 → Next构建套件选择选择Desktop Qt 5.15.2 MinGW 64-bit点击Finish完成创建3. 编译并运行项目点击左侧运行按钮 ▶或按 CtrlR等待编译完成弹出空白窗口窗口正常显示 →Qt 环境搭建成功七、常见问题与解决方法1. 安装时报错路径包含中文 / 空格解决卸载重装安装路径纯英文。2. 构建套件 (Kit) 显示红色感叹号原因编译器未配置解决Tools → Options → Kits → 选择对应 Kit → 编译器选择 MinGW 7.3.03. 运行报错缺少 dll 文件解决重新配置环境变量或使用windeployqt工具打包依赖。4. 中文乱码解决代码文件保存为UTF-8Qt Creator 中Tools → Options → Text Editor → Behavior → File Encoding 选择 UTF-8八、总结本文完成了Qt 下载、安装、组件选择系统环境变量配置Qt Creator 初始化 第一个项目测试常见问题快速解决搭建完成后即可开始 Qt 桌面应用、嵌入式界面、工控软件等开发工作。总结Qt 安装路径严禁中文、空格新手优先选Qt 5.15.2 MinGW 64 位核心组件Qt 版本库 MinGW 编译器 Qt Creator环境配置完成后创建 Widgets 项目运行成功即代表搭建完成遇到报错优先检查路径、编译器选择、环境变量如果本文对你有帮助欢迎点赞、收藏、评论如有疑问或补充欢迎在评论区交流探讨日常深耕嵌入式、物联网、协议开发相关技术有技术答疑、项目合作、毕设指导需求均可私信私聊

更多文章